France is known all over the world for its food, both savoury dishes or sweet. There are a number of traditional foods that are well known, such as cheese and pastries, depending on which part of the country you are in. Don’t worry … even if you have heard that they eat snails, frogs’ legs and rabbit in France, it is not really very common. However, if you are a little bit adventurous it is a very good experience to try. French cuisine is very good. The French love to eat and mealtimes are very important. Dinner is the most important meal during the week because everyone can be together after work, but during the weekend, lunch may be the main meal of the day. Extended family meals for a special event may start at 12pm and not finish till 5pm, with multiple courses served, eg, an appetizer, entrée, main, salad, cheese, dessert. It is rare to find a vegetarian family in France, even more so for a vegan, and gluten is common in most households as French bread is much-loved!
